Sen. Trent Lott
(R-Miss.)
-
Residence:Pascagoula
-
Born:October 9, 1941; Grenada County, Miss.
-
Religion:Baptist
-
Family:Wife, Patricia Elizabeth Lott; two children
-
Education:U. of Mississippi, B.P.A. 1963 (public administration) ; U. of Mississippi, J.D. 1967
-
Military service:None
-
Career:Lawyer; congressional aide
-
Political Highlights:U.S. House, 1973-89; U.S. Senate, 1989-present
-
Elected:1988 (4th term)
-
Note: Will resign before end of current term; Assistant Minority Leader
